Corneliu Michailescu made this ink drawing, Composition, in 1960. Michailescu lived through a tumultuous period in Romanian history, experiencing both World Wars and the rise of Communist Romania. The drawing presents a scene of abstracted forms and figures, with a figure at the lower left that seems to be sleeping. The artist plays with the interplay between solid forms and negative space in the work, creating a sense of depth and ambiguity that reflects the mood in the Eastern Bloc at the time. The lines are bold and the composition is dynamic, hinting at the way that identities are made ambiguous in times of political turmoil. Michailescu's Composition invites us to consider the complex relationship between personal identity and political reality.
